Given our hilly terrain and seasonal temperature swings, we frequently service Honda vehicles for worn suspension components, brake wear from stop-and-go lake traffic, and battery issues due to extreme summer heat and winter cold. Honda Odyssey and Pilot models also commonly need attention for transmission maintenance and power sliding door mechanisms.

You should have your suspension, steering, and undercarriage inspected more frequently than the standard schedule, such as with every oil change. Gravel roads accelerate wear on CV joints, struts, and can cause rock chips in vital components, making proactive checks essential to avoid being stranded in a remote area.

Before summer, prioritize cooling system checks and A/C service for lake-season traffic. Before winter, focus on battery testing, ensuring all-weather tires are in good condition, and checking the heating system for our colder, humid months, as road salt from state routes can also accelerate corrosion.
